2 回答

TA貢獻(xiàn)1887條經(jīng)驗(yàn) 獲得超5個(gè)贊
node.js...它既是開發(fā)平臺(tái), 也是運(yùn)行環(huán)境, 也是個(gè)新的語言...它本身是基于google的javascript v8引擎開發(fā)的, 因此在編寫基于它的代碼的時(shí)候使用javascript語言. 但是又不同于傳統(tǒng)概念的javascript...它的服務(wù)端功能以及部分客戶端功能必須在服務(wù)端運(yùn)行, 所以它實(shí)際上是一種在服務(wù)端的開發(fā)+運(yùn)行的javascript語言. 有一點(diǎn)類似于Perl + PHP或者Python的概念. 它本身可以作為HTTP Server, 也可以當(dāng)作TCP Server用. 基本上就是這樣...

TA貢獻(xiàn)2037條經(jīng)驗(yàn) 獲得超6個(gè)贊
“Node 是一個(gè)服務(wù)器端 JavaScript 解釋器,它將改變服務(wù)器應(yīng)該如何工作的概念。它的目標(biāo)是幫助程序員構(gòu)建高度可伸縮的應(yīng)用程序,編寫能夠處理數(shù)萬條同時(shí)連接到一個(gè)(只有一個(gè))物理機(jī)的連接代碼?!?br/>
優(yōu)點(diǎn):
js是跨平臺(tái)的,手機(jī)、平板電腦、筆記本、個(gè)人電腦等隨處可見它的身影,降低跨平臺(tái)開發(fā)的難度;
Node 并不只是 Apache 的一個(gè)替代品,它旨在使 PHP Web 應(yīng)用程序更容易伸縮;
Node 表現(xiàn)出眾的典型示例包括:RESTful API、Twitter 隊(duì)列、電子游戲統(tǒng)計(jì)數(shù)據(jù)。
綜上所述,它是一種新型的應(yīng)用,旨在解決某類問題,如類似ajax的出現(xiàn),學(xué)會(huì)用它,可以讓你的價(jià)值增倍....
- 2 回答
- 0 關(guān)注
- 576 瀏覽
添加回答
舉報(bào)